UK weather: Showers threaten Jubilee bank holiday weekend washout, forecasters warn
Wet weather is threatening a Jubilee bank holiday weekend washout, forecasters have warned. The Queen’s Platinum Jubilee , a four day extended bank holiday from Thursday 2 to Sunday 5 June 2022, will see events and activities celebrating the event erupt across the UK . According to the official Jubilee webpage , an impressive 2,429 public events and 2,579 parties or private events have been planned in the UK so far. And street parties, a staple of major Royal celebrations, are expected to attract more than ten million Britons. But forecasters have urged partygoers up and down the country to make preparations to keep a “good raincoat or a gazebo” in tow to avoid soggy clothes and sandwiches as showers threaten to rain on the four-day parade. Flood and surf warnings as wild wet weather hits Australian cities
Heavy rain is forecast for Brisbane, Sydney and Perth on Tuesday, triggering flood and surf warnings across Australia. The extremely wet weather is expected after the three cities were already hit with wild conditions on Monday, leaving thousands of people in Western Australia without power, and causing flights to delayed by hours in Sydney. Almost continuous rain is forecast for Brisbane and Sydney every day until Sunday. There is hazardous surf warning in place right from Fraser Island to Batemans Bay in the Far North Coast of New South Wales , while a flood warning has been issued for the Northern Rivers. UK weather: The UK’s record-breaking heat in maps and charts
Published 25 July 2019 Share close Share page Copy link About sharing The UK has had its hottest July day on record - with temperatures reaching 38.1C in Cambridge on Thursday. The all-time record in the UK still stands at 38.5C recorded at Faversham, Kent, in 2003. So just how does the current hot spell compare? The heat is rising Only three of the top 10 hottest temperatures in the UK have been recorded in July, according to Met Office figures, the others were all in August. Records could also be broken elsewhere. Northern Ireland has the lowest record high temperature - 30.8C reached in June 1976 and again in July 1983, at Knockarevan, in County Fermanagh, and Shaw's Bridge, Belfast, respectively. Overnight records could be broken too Temperatures have also been high overnight, approaching the all-time record of 23.9C, set in August 1990.
